Power and Control Considerations
The ARGB lighting draws power via a 5V 3-PIN connector. This standard interface ensures compatibility with modern motherboards. A SATA power adapter is also included for alternative power sourcing.
Proper connection to a 5V 3-PIN ARGB header is crucial. Connecting to a 12V 4-PIN RGB header will damage the LEDs. Always verify the header type before connecting.
The inclusion of a SATA power adapter provides flexibility. It allows users without sufficient motherboard ARGB headers to still power the lighting. This ensures broader system integration possibilities.
Clearance and Case Fitment
The heatsink adds approximately 1.97 inches (50mm) to the height of a standard RAM module. This increased height is a critical factor for system planning. It impacts compatibility with large CPU air coolers.
PC builders must measure the available clearance in their case. The distance between the RAM slots and the CPU cooler fan or top-mounted case fans needs verification. This prevents physical interference.
